15.5 MIDI

• 16 channels MIDI
• 5-pin DIN jacks
• Optocoupled, ground-free input
MADI
• Invisible transmission via User bit of channel 56 (48k frame)

15.6 General

• Dimensions including rack ears (WxHxD): 483 x 88 x 242 mm (19" x 3.46" x 9.5")
• Dimensions without rack ears/handles (WxHxD): 436 x 88 x 235 mm (17.2" x 3.46" x 9.3")
• Temperature range: +5° up to +50° Celsius (41° F up to 122°F)
• Relative humidity: < 75%, non condensing
M-32 DA
• Power supply: Internal switching PSU, 100 - 240 V AC, 40 Watt
• Typical power consumption: 23 Watt
• Max. power consumption: < 30 Watt
• Weight: 3 kg ( 6.6 lbs)
M-16 DA
• Power supply: Internal switching PSU, 100 - 240 V AC, 40 Watt
• Typical power consumption: 15 Watt
• Max. power consumption: < 20 Watt
• Weight: 2.5 kg ( 5.5 lbs)

15.7 Firmware

The M-Series is internally based on programmable logic. By re-programming of a little compo-
nent called Flash-PROM, both function and behaviour of the unit can be changed at any time.
At the time of writing this manual, M-32 DA and M-16 DA are shipping with firmware 1.5. The
firmware version is displayed after power on for about one second on the level meters of the M-
series units.
Firmware 1.5: Initial release
Firmware 2.1: The temperature inside the unit can be read via MIDI. The fan operation can be
changed via MIDI.

15.8 MADI User Bit Chart

• RS-232: channels 1 to 9 (passed-through by the M-series)
• ADC: channel 19
• MIDI: channel 56 (48k) / 28 (96k)
